Job Title: Exchange Administrator Location: Washington, DC Salary: $110,000 - $115,000 (Maximum) Duration: 6-month Contract to Hire Hourly Rate: $50/hr Clearance Level: Top Secret (Active) Client: Department of Justice (DOJ) Summary: We are currently seeking an experienced Exchange Administrator to join our team in Washington, DC, in support of the Department of Justice (DOJ). This is a 6-month contract to hire position with a maximum salary of $110,000 - $115,000.

The ideal candidate will have at least 5 years of Exchange Administrator experience and must possess an active Top Secret clearance.

Experience with Client Access Servers is highly desirable.

Responsibilities: Manage and maintain Exchange Server environments, ensuring high availability and performance.

Perform Exchange Server installations, configurations, upgrades, and migrations.

Monitor and troubleshoot Exchange Server issues, including mail flow, connectivity, and performance problems.

Implement and manage Exchange Server security measures and policies.

Collaborate with other IT teams to integrate Exchange Server with other systems and applications.

Provide technical support and assistance to end-users regarding Exchange Server-related issues.

Maintain documentation related to Exchange Server configurations, procedures, and best practices.

Participate in on-call rotation and provide support during off-hours as needed.

Requirements: Active Top Secret clearance is mandatory.

Bachelor's degree in Computer Science, Information Technology, or related field preferred.

Minimum of 5 years of experience as an Exchange Administrator in enterprise environments.

Strong knowledge of Microsoft Exchange Server (2013, 2016, or 2019). Experience with Client Access Servers (CAS) and related technologies.

Proficiency in PowerShell scripting for Exchange Server administration tasks.

Excellent troubleshooting skills and ability to resolve complex Exchange Server issues.

Strong communication and interpersonal skills.

Ability to work independently and collaboratively in a team environment.

Relevant Microsoft certifications (e.g., MCSE: Messaging) are a plus.
